Categories     Dessert

Time 22m

Yield 24-30 cookies, 24 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 cup sweet rice flour
1/2 cup tapioca flour
1 1/4 cups cornstarch
1/8 cup potato starch (plus extra 1/8 cup for rolling this out)
1 teaspoon baking powder
2 1/2 teaspoons xanthan gum (can be skipped if needed)
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up unsalted butter (room temperature)
1 medium egg
1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
1/2 teaspoon butter flavoring
1/4 teaspoon almond extract
1 cup powdered sugar
1/2 cup jam (I like seedless raspberry and apricot)

Steps:

  • *Set oven to 350°F.
  • 1) Sift together white rice flour, tapioca flour, cornstarch, potato starch, baking powder, xanthan gum and salt in small bowl and set aside.
  • 2) Cream butter and sugar on med-high in mixer with whip.
  • 3) Add vanilla, almond extract, butter flavoring and egg then mix for 30 seconds on medium.
  • 4) Carefully add in dry mixture on low speed and mix until just combined.
  • 5) Dust counter with more potato starch and pull dough out into a ball on there, roll out until 1/8" thick (can be a bit thicker).
  • 6) Cut out circles with a round cutter, then cut out half of those with a smaller cookie cutter to form an "O".
  • 7) Slide a spatula under them to transfer to ungreased cookie sheets. Take scraps a cut-outs, roll again (will not get tough).
  • 8) Bake for about 11-12 minutes, do not let these brown. Cool completely on wire rack, dust "O" shapes with powdered sugar while still warm.
  • 9) Spread 1 tsp of jam/jelly on circles, carefully press the dusted "O" on top.
  • *Can use any shape cut out, hearts would be perfect for Valentine's Day.
